The Fundamental Function of the Automotive Crankshaft

At its core, the automotive crankshaft transforms the up-and-down reciprocating motion generated by the engine’s pistons into rotary motion, which drives the wheels through the transmission. This transformation is critical for vehicle operation, making the crankshaft the "heart" of an engine. Any inefficiency or failure within the crankshaft can lead to catastrophic engine damage, reduced efficiency, or complete engine failure.

Design and Construction of the Automotive Crankshaft

A high-performing automotive crankshaft requires meticulous design and manufacturing. It is typically made from forged steel or cast iron, with forged steel offering superior strength, durability, and resistance to fatigue. The design involves precise balancing, smooth bearing surfaces, and specific weight distributions to minimize vibrations and optimize engine timing.

Importance of Material Quality in Manufacturing Automotive Crankshafts

The choice of material substantially influences the durability and performance of the automotive crankshaft. Forged steel crankshafts, for example, undergo rigorous heat treatment to improve tensile strength and fatigue resistance. Cast iron crankshafts, while more economical, are often reserved for lower-performance engines due to their comparatively lower strength and lifespan.

The Manufacturing Process of Crankshafts

The production of high-quality automotive crankshafts involves several steps:

  1. Material Selection: Choosing the appropriate steel or cast iron alloy.
  2. Forging or Casting: Forming the basic shape with forging for higher strength or casting for cost-efficiency.
  3. Machining: Precision machining to achieve exact dimensions and smooth surface finishes.
  4. Heat Treatment: Enhancing mechanical properties like strength and fatigue resistance through processes like quenching and tempering.
  5. Balancing and Inspection: Ensuring the crankshaft is perfectly balanced to prevent vibrations and checking for imperfections or deviations.

Maintenance and Inspection of Crankshafts in Business Operations

For businesses responsible for vehicle repairs and maintenance, understanding the signs of crankshaft wear and failure is crucial. Common symptoms include unusual engine vibrations, knocking noises during acceleration, decreased power output, and oil consumption issues.

Regular inspection involving visual checks and vibrational analysis can prevent catastrophic failures. Replacing worn or damaged crankshafts with high-quality parts from trusted suppliers ensures uninterrupted service quality and customer satisfaction.
